Transaction b020744f434a31594f91f9107fef0767f3025f368ae0ccd91129edfe41928096

2 Input
2 Outputs
  • b020744f434a31594f91f9107fef0767f3025f368ae0ccd91129edfe41928096:0
  • value  1000000
    address  2MucqDe2ENyARF6mMHpR1HYiVKRe6NqjcHf
  • b020744f434a31594f91f9107fef0767f3025f368ae0ccd91129edfe41928096:1
  • value  1499462
    address  2NGC4VJEtSAoYS4WNwcs42kfHBxVxMm45Eh